Skidbladnir-Parashield was a test of an deployable umbrella-like heat-shield made of silicon fabric developed by University of Maryland's Space Systems Laboratory. It was to be tested on the maiden flight of the Amroc-SET rocket, but the launch failed and the experiment was destroyed.
